Janin's Jacks Juice Up His Stack

Level 16 : Blinds 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

The under-the-gun player opened to 12,000 and Gregory Janin called from the middle position. Roman Hrabec was in the big blind and three-bet to 48,000, and only Janin called.

On the 382 flop, Hrabec bet 13,000, and Janin called.

Both players then checked to showdown on the 10 turn and 8 river. Hrabec tabled AK for ace-high, but Janin had the winner with JJ for a pair of jacks.

Hallay Takes From Li and Peters

Level 16 : Blinds 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

Axel Hallay opened to 13,000 from under the gun. After he was called by Yan Li in middle position, he quickly called the clock when the small blind went into the tank. The small blind eventually folded and Tobias Peters defended from the big blind.

All three players checked the 98J flop leading to the 8 turn where Peters checked again. Hallay decided to bet 15,000 and made both Li and Peters fold.

Trips for Madanzhiev

Level 17 : Blinds 4,000/8,000, 8,000 ante

Heads-up on a board of 97296 with approximately 90,000 in the pot, Stoyan Madanzhiev in the big blind bet 75,000 and put a player in middle position into the tank.

The middle-position player eventually called, but sent his cards into the muck when Madanzhiev flipped over 109 for trips.

Lightbourne Survives

Level 17 : Blinds 4,000/8,000, 8,000 ante

Iaron Lightbourne was forced all in from the big blind but managed to find a way to survive despite being dominated.

Iaron Lightbourne: 108 All in
Xuan Liu: K10

The runout of 410687 gave Lightbourne two pair which kept him alive with just two more eliminations to go until the money.
